What companies run services between Matlock, England and Sutton Coldfield, England?

You can take a train from Matlock to Sutton Coldfield via Derby and Birmingham New Street in around 2h 4m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Olde Englishe Road to Bishop Vesey's School via Bus Station, Market Place, New Street, and Bus Station in around 3h 8m.
